Vendors of slope greening equipment usually start from many aspects when selecting greening plants, but they should consider the main role, that is, preventing water and soil loss, preventing collapse caused by rainstorm scouring, and then considering the role of decoration and concealment.
So, with the aim of preventing soil erosion, how to choose green plants? What are the characteristics of plants that need to be considered? Let the slope greening equipment seller tell you how to choose green plants.
1. Choose some local vines or vines that are tolerant to poor soil and drought, and grow vigorously, such as pomegranate, kudzu, and ivy. When the coverage of local vine plants on the slope reaches over 60%, replanting some local nitrogen fixing fast-growing grass species can achieve the original ecological greening effect.

3. The exposed slopes with strong resistance are prone to soil erosion and biodiversity reduction. In addition, the soil slopes of highways are barren, with steep slopes and diverse climate types. Green plants have strong stress resistance, early emergence, strong expansion, fast growth rate, deep and developed root systems, and strong slope stabilization ability, so as to quickly establish plant communities and play a role in preventing soil erosion as soon as possible.

For sowing greening, the sowing amount varies with the nature of the soil and seeds, and the germination rate and survival rate of different plant seeds are different. Under different geological and climatic conditions, the germination and survival rates of seeds may also vary, and appropriate adjustments should be made to achieve the desired greening effect.
